Polar coordinates are a representation in terms of a given longitude r, and an orientation given by an angle. (Please see attached image)

Since the polar coordinate is cyclic (The values from the angle go from 0 to 2π and then go through the same values again) if we add or subtract 2π, from any value we find ourselves in the same initial position

So, any point can be represented by

(r, θ ± 2π)
